温馨提示×

linux vsftp匿名访问开启

小樊
82
2025-01-01 10:12:44
栏目: 智能运维

在Linux系统中,要启用vsftpd的匿名访问,请按照以下步骤操作:

  1. 打开vsftpd配置文件:
sudo nano /etc/vsftpd.conf
  1. 在配置文件中找到以下设置并进行修改:

找到或添加以下设置:

anonymous_enable=YES
local_enable=YES
write_enable=YES
chroot_local_user=NO
allow_writeable_chroot=YES
  • anonymous_enable=YES:启用匿名访问。
  • local_enable=YES:允许本地用户登录(如果需要)。
  • write_enable=YES:允许匿名用户上传文件(如果需要)。
  • chroot_local_user=NO:允许匿名用户访问整个文件系统(如果需要)。
  • allow_writeable_chroot=YES:允许chroot目录可写(如果需要)。
  1. 保存并退出配置文件。

  2. 重启vsftpd服务以使更改生效:

sudo systemctl restart vsftpd

现在,vsftpd已经启用了匿名访问。用户可以通过匿名用户登录,但请注意,这样做可能会带来安全风险。确保采取适当的安全措施,例如限制IP地址访问、禁用不必要的功能等。

0